Output 036f426f7655bac66eca233e4edb02d6a0de8f98f1f2e9c2fff1a0108a63a037:2

value
5727088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3b4ddf57ffd0986fc84f5c7e0af1a20b96ff63 OP_EQUAL
address
3Ef4vJzP1pLrBSKaKo7CfifXghytmcbpqa
transaction
036f426f7655bac66eca233e4edb02d6a0de8f98f1f2e9c2fff1a0108a63a037
confirmations
212090
spent
true